Food Irradiation:

Activism at the Crossroads by Don Norman There has been a subtle change in the style and information given in the articles filling the mainstream press on food irradiation. Two years ago it was impossible to get anyone's attention. Now US News and World Report and ~ have given full page articles, and there are good articles in MS. (Nov, 1985) and the multitude of "Health" journals, such as East-West Journal Harrowsmith. and New Frontier. As the bland articles have been written for less polarized audiences, they have massaged the issue into a more chic and humorous cxmtroversy: "The mixing of gamma rays with edibles has set off a nuclear chain reaction, releasing high rhetoric, short tempers, and
